    JMH-Having followed hockey for so long I begin to confuse the seasons-but you are right. This game has changed in so many ways. The entire emphasis has been altered. I know we have not seen a 30+ goal scorer in the ECAC in over 11 years-from any of the teams. I do not have a solution-I do not think they can take away shot blocking-it is just a very valuable part of the game. The goalies are better-for sure. The equipment is better. The defensemen are much bigger yet can skate as well as the forwards. When i first started in college hockey a big forward was about 175 pounds and the usual defensemen was considered huge at 190-200.pounds. Coaches spend so much time on defense and penalty killing that even a 5 on 3 is no longer a guarantee of scoring. I would not want to see too much tampering with the game-I am an old fashioned old time hockey guy. As long as it does not get as bad as soccer (with every game seemingly ending 1-0) I can live with what we seem to have now. Perhaps both our attitudes about low scoring might change once we start pumping a few into the net as this season goes on.

                    You have hit the nail on the head. The trap is as important to holding down scoring as anything in the game. Variations of it have been used for ages. Whether you call it the Left Wing Lock or something else, all of it is designed to prevent the other team from scoring. One thing that might be tried-is to revrse the old 'Gretzky' rule that the NHL instituted way back when teams draw matching penalties. Perhaps on ice strength should be reduced for every matching penalty-making for lots more 4 on 4 or even 3 on 3 play. I would find that very acceptable-for me it would even be bringing back the wide open hockey I used to enjoy as a kid.
